Materials and details that make the difference
Wool delivers performance – naturally
Keeping you warm when it’s cold and comfortable when it’s mild, wool has natural temperature-regulating properties, making it a practical fibre for year-round wear. Odour and dirt resistant and maintaining its thermal properties when damp, it’s also a favourite for active days in nature.

FAQ
Can I wash a wool sweater in the washing machine?
You don’t need to wash wool that often. In most cases, a good airing out will keep your sweater feeling fresh. If you notice smells or soiling, however, first check the washing instructions on the care label, as some wool garments should simply never be washed. If it can be machine-washed, use a mild or wool-specific detergent, a low temperature and, the wool or hand-wash setting. Use the lowest spin cycle available.
If hand washing, don’t leave wool clothing soaking for a long time. Instead, lift it in and out of the water several times, then remove excess water with a towel. Do not wring it out. Reshape the item after washing and lay it flat to dry.
Do not tumble dry your wool clothing!
